Lug Radio Live 2006 is being held on Sat 22nd and Sun 23rd July 2006 at
Wolverhampton University Students' Union, Wulfruna Street Wolverhampton
WV1 1LY
From the blurb, for those who haven't heard of it:
"LUGRadio Live is an annual event driven by, and for the Open Source
community. The event includes a range of speakers, exhibitors and other
attractions, all housed within a unique event with a unique atmosphere.
Last years event in June 2005 was a huge success, and this year LUGRadio
Live 2006 will be nothing you have seen before."
K/Ubuntu will be having a strong presence, featuring a number of talks
by developers, etc.
As part of this, there is the opportunity to hold BOF (Birds of a
Feather) sessions:
http://wiki.lugradio.org/index.php/LUGRadio_Live_2006_BOFs
One of these - following on from the emails on Ubuntu Advocacy - is on
Linux advocacy.
Would anyone be interested in a Ubuntu Users BOF? Where we can meet, get
to put faces to names, etc?
